Output 9fbd9bc911a301528e6357f2e9feb56c21c9f119673a41865e19a4a4bd10730a:20

value
17297028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c4508c8a77526ce43b3bc493e64a84dda9fa73 OP_EQUAL
address
3NpVC37RNAW77jDre5XD9icMm7uaafkYnx
transaction
9fbd9bc911a301528e6357f2e9feb56c21c9f119673a41865e19a4a4bd10730a
spent
true